Dell XPS-M1730
Processor
*Intel Core 2 Duo Processor 2.2GHz / T7500
Cache Memory
* 4Mb
Memory
* 2GB DDR2 SDRAM
Video Card
*512Mb Dual NVIDIA(R) GeForce(R) 8700M GT graphics with NVIDIA SLI Technology
Hard Drive
*2 x 160GB SATA HDD
DVD/RW
*DVD±RW Drive supporting DVD+R Double Layer
Display
*17.0" UltraSharp(TM) Widescreen WUXGA (1920x1200)
Interfaces
*4 USB 2.0
*Dual-link DVI-I (support for 30-inch displays)
*HDMI via DVI adapter
*VGA via DVI dongle
*Firewire (IEEE 1394a)
*RJ45 Ethernet port (10/100/1000)
*S-video with component, composite, S/PDIF support through dongle
*8-in-1 card reader
*ExpressCard 54 mm slot
*Consumer IR
*Dual headphones, microphone (stereo line-in) and support for 5.1 audio out
Network
*Intel(R) PRO/Wireless 3945 Dual Band 802.11a/g 54Mbps Wireless Mini Card
Bluetooth
* Dell Wireless 355 Bluetooth Module
Audio
* High definition integrated stereo sound
Battery
*9-CELL LITHIUM ION PRIMARY BATTERY
Weight & Dimensions
*Weight: Starting at 10.6 lbs4 (4.81 kg)
*Width: 16.0" (406 mm)
*Height: <2.00" (50.7 mm)
*Depth: 11.9" (302.6 mm)
Operating System
*Windows(R) Vista Business (English) - installed and CD
